Saturday’s will never be the same again! I could end the review right there and post the link to the most fabulous Saturday eatery and bar in London, but that would be boring.

The Refinery Regent’s place have brought back their Reef, Beef & Bubbles menu on a Saturday from 5pm-10pm, it is the best way to indulge on a lazy Saturday evening for only £19.95, enjoy The Refinery’s own version of the ‘surf & turf’ with half a fresh lobster and a 6oz rump steak with triple cooked chips. That’s not all, you get an ice-cold flute of Prosecco to top it all off.

When we first walked into The Refinery we were in awe with is calm and collected décor, seats adorned with fur shrugs and the stylish bar wall filled with bottles of wine (any wall filled with wine is a good sign of things to come). The staffs were friendly and willing to help navigate my friend and I through the starters menu, if we knew how full we would have become from our reef and beef mains we probably would have taken it easy.

The Refinery

We chose the calamari, which had a beautiful batter with a gentle black pepper spice to it; the squid came accompanied with a lemon mayonnaise that had a tangy taste that was perfect with the crisp saltiness of the calamari. I decided to try the scotch egg with black pudding and piccalilli, I love scotch eggs and the black pudding take added some depth to what would normally be a packed lunch type snack, I totally recommend it. The starter that won our hearts was the prawn lollipops, they came beautifully presented on lollipop sticks and the prawns were tender and juicy covered in a crispy batter, dipped in the sweet chili and soy sauce we were in food heaven.

The main was the star of the night by a long shot. The beef was cooked perfectly and went well with the lobster. The lobster was fresh and tasted divine, there were no complaints from us. Accompanied with the Prosecco it made for a wonderful night and the atmosphere was perfect we felt like we were eating at home and chatted and drank into the later hours. To feel comfortable in a restaurant tops amazing food at times, but The Refinery has the perfect balance of great food and a warm atmosphere.
